World Health Day 2023

Apr 06, 2023

This World Health Day, we are focusing on what it means to be truly well. But a healthy lifestyle isn’t just about eating well. It isn’t just down to getting enough exercise and movement. It isn’t just about sleeping well. It isn't just about being a good space psychologically. It’s when we tie all of these things together, that we experience true health and vitality.



The Importance of Nutrition

Eating a healthy diet is all about vitality - it’s about supplying your body with all of the essential nutrients it needs to function properly. Supplying your body with the right nutrients looks like eating a well balanced and varied diet, eating mostly whole foods, and including all 5 of the food groups (fruits, vegetables, grains, dairy & proteins) to include all micronutrients. The body also requires all macronutrients, being quality carbohydrates, lean protein, essential fats, as well as proper hydration and fluids.

The Importance of Sleep

We all know how much sleep affects our energy and mental health - but it actually is just as important as nutrition - it also affects much more. If you’re not sleeping well, it can be impossible to focus on and improve other aspects of your health – such as movement, mental health and nutrition. Just like your legs need rest after an intense workout, your brain needs rest after a long day. If you're struggling to get a good night’s sleep, there are so many small steps you can take to make an improvement. A big one is reducing your blue light exposure (scrolling) at night, so swap instagram for a book to help you fall into a slumber easier. 

The Importance of Movement

Your body loves moving! Start by simply moving more throughout your day - take the stairs, park further away from your destination and walk, get up and take a walk around the office every hour. Actively exercising 30 minutes per day improves your heart, immune and brain health and more. Exercise also has positive effects on things like blood pressure, bone health, energy levels plus improves your mood. 


The Importance of Mental Wellness 

Practising mindfulness or meditation is taking the world by storm at the moment, and for good reason. Prioritising your mental health is just as important as your physiological health. Relaxed mental downtime is so important for helping anxiety, depression, insomnia, pain and even high blood pressure. Just 5-10 minutes of mental stillness per day is all you need to start seeing the benefits.
